The Key Account Manager (KAM) will play a crucial role in managing and strengthening relationships with key retail partners, driving business growth and ensuring the achievement of sales targets. This position is responsible for account planning, negotiation, in-store execution, pricing strategies, and overseeing the overall P&L for key accounts. The KAM will ensure that business objectives are met by delivering exceptional account management and fostering long-term, mutually beneficial partnerships.
Responsibilities
- Responsible and accountable for delivering set target with proper planning, and ensuring all operational matters such as order facilitation, on-shelf availability, inventory management, in-store merchandising, and sales target of all designated key accounts are carried out. To develop business and sales plan, through comprehensive account and market knowledge.
- Manage key accounts by working with buyers, conducting campaigns, negotiating and executing merchandising excellence
- Conduct quarterly key account business review
- Provide quality input to marketing initiatives and assist in formulation of strategic sales opportunities.
- Develop excellent working relationships and in-depth understanding with the customers and market landscape.
- Responsible for the effective management of promotional spending, and overall profitability of each key customer
- Responsible and accountable for sales growth targets, profitability, managing market hygiene and total trade spend within allowable with the assigned key accounts.
- Responsible for key account receivables. Monitor Account Receivable ageing and coordinate with credit control and Accounts Receivable team.
- To be working with cross-functional colleagues to ensure excellence in-store execution.
- To compile and submit reports on key account activities in accordance to established formats and schedule.
